Understanding the Boston Scientific Accolade MRI Pacemaker
The Boston Scientific Accolade MRI is a cardiac pacing device developed to treat slow heart rhythms. It works by delivering small electrical impulses to the heart muscle, ensuring it maintains an adequate rate to meet the body’s needs. What sets it apart is its full-body MRI conditional approval, meaning patients can safely undergo MRI scans under specific guidelines without removing or replacing the device.
Why MRI Compatibility Matters
Traditional pacemakers often limited a patient’s ability to undergo MRI scans because the strong magnetic fields could interfere with device function, potentially leading to serious complications. With the Accolade MRI system, patients can benefit from the diagnostic power of MRI technology while still receiving continuous heart rhythm management. This innovation reduces the need for alternative, sometimes less accurate, imaging methods.

How the Accolade MRI Works
The device is implanted under the skin, typically near the collarbone. Leads, or thin insulated wires, run from the pacemaker into the heart chambers to deliver electrical impulses. The Accolade MRI continuously monitors the heart’s activity and delivers pacing when the heart rate falls below a preset threshold. In MRI mode, the device’s programming is adjusted to ensure safe operation during the scan.
Mode Switch During MRI
Before an MRI scan, the device is put into a specific mode designed to handle the magnetic environment. This prevents unwanted pacing changes or interference. After the scan, the pacemaker is returned to its normal operating mode, ensuring uninterrupted cardiac support.

Indications for Use
The Boston Scientific Accolade MRI is recommended for patients with bradycardia, sinus node dysfunction, or other conduction disorders that require pacing support. It is suitable for individuals who may also have other medical conditions requiring MRI for ongoing monitoring.
Patient Selection
Not every patient is automatically a candidate for MRI-conditional pacemakers. Physicians evaluate overall health, heart condition, and the likelihood of needing future MRI scans before recommending the Accolade MRI.
Safety Guidelines for MRI with Accolade MRI
- MRI scans must be performed in approved MRI systems following Boston Scientific guidelines.
- The pacemaker should be programmed into MRI mode before the scan and restored afterward.
- Healthcare teams should confirm device compatibility and lead conditions before the procedure.
- Continuous monitoring is advised during the MRI scan to ensure patient safety.
Physician and Patient Coordination
Safe MRI scanning with this device requires close coordination between cardiologists, radiologists, and the MRI technologist. Pre-scan preparation and post-scan follow-up are essential for optimal results.
